Her mission is to infiltrate and destroy the strongholds of the city of Bregna / ˈ b r ɛ n j ə/, which is led by her sworn enemy, and sometimes lover, Trevor Goodchild, the technocratic dictator of Bregna, whose citizens are called Breens. The title character is a tall, sexy, dominatrix scantily-clad secret agent from the city of Monica, skilled in espionage, assassination and acrobatics. The setting comprises a bizarre dystopia populated by mutant creatures, clones, and robots set within the two separated border wall cities of Monica and Bregna. Æon Flux is set in a surreal German Expressionist style futuristic universe. Each Episode plots have elements of social science fiction, biopunk, allegory, dystopian fiction, spy fiction, psychological drama, postmodern visual, psychedelic imagery and Gnostic symbolism. Æon Flux was created by American animator Peter Chung. In 1995, a season of ten half-hour episodes aired as a stand-alone series. It premiered on MTV's Liquid Television experimental animation show, as a six-part serial of short films, followed in 1992 by five individual short episodes. Æon Flux / ˌ iː ɒ n ˈ f l ʌ k s/ is an American avant-garde science fiction adventure animated television series that aired on MTV from November 30, 1991, until October 10, 1995, with film, comic book, and video game adaptations following thereafter.
